Thomas Jefferson: A Teacher's Guide and Video Segment Index.
Osterman, Leah, Ed.; Logan, Claudia
This teacher's guide accompanies the Public Broadcasting System (PBS) two-part videotape documentary that uses portraits and paintings, original architectural drawings and excerpts from Thomas Jefferson's journals, letters, scientific papers, and political writings to tell the story of this remarkable yet contradictory man. The guide introduces the documentary's major themes through 5 lessons which focus on the events, people, and philosophies that shaped Jefferson's life. Because portraits are used throughout the documentary to portray Jefferson at various stages in his life, this guide includes an introductory lesson on how to view and interpret portraits. Each subsequent lesson gives an activity that asks students to consider how they might, through the use of portraits, portray Jefferson at various stages of his life. The lessons are: (1) "Images of Jefferson"; (2) "Liberty: Our Sacred Honor"; (3) "The Head and the Heart"; (4) "Age of Experiments"; and (5) "The Pursuit of Happiness." Each lesson includes background information, discussion questions, activities for individual, small group, or whole class involvement, and a bibliography. The accompanying video segment index indicates the volume, hour, minute and second that material about a key event, theme, place, or person featured in the video will occur. There are an alphabetical index and a subject index focusing on events, issues, organizations and groups, people, and places. (MM)
